What is a Gommone?

A gommone is an inflatable boat typically made from durable, flexible materials such as PVC or Hypalon, a synthetic rubber. It consists of inflatable tubes that surround a central platform, which can be made from a variety of materials, including wood, aluminum, or fiberglass. The air-filled tubes provide buoyancy and stability on the water, allowing the boat to float and be maneuvered easily.

The design of the gommone can vary depending on its intended use. Some models feature rigid hulls (commonly referred to as RIBs – Rigid Inflatable Boats), while others have fully inflatable bodies. Regardless of the design, the key characteristics of a gommone include lightweight construction, ease of transport, and the ability to quickly inflate or deflate.

History of the Gommone

The origin of the gommone dates back to the early 20th century, with the first inflatable boats being designed for military use. However, it was in the 1960s and 1970s that inflatable boats began to gain popularity for recreational and commercial use. Italian manufacturers played a significant role in developing and popularizing the gommone, which is why the term "gommone" is commonly used in Italy and surrounding regions to refer to inflatable boats.

Types of Gommone

There are several types of gommone, each tailored to specific applications. Here are some of the most common varieties:

  1. Rigid Inflatable Boats (RIBs): These boats combine the durability and performance of a rigid hull with the flexibility of inflatable tubes. RIBs are known for their excellent stability, speed, and ability to handle rough water. They are often used by military forces, coast guards, and rescue teams, but also by recreational boaters seeking a high-performance vessel.

  2. Inflatable Dinghies: Smaller and more compact than RIBs, inflatable dinghies are commonly used for short-distance travel or as tenders to larger yachts. They are ideal for leisure activities like fishing, exploring, or beach landings.

  3. High-Speed Inflatable Boats: Designed for speed and agility, these boats are favored by thrill-seekers and those involved in water sports. They are often equipped with powerful engines and designed to cut through waves with ease.

  4. Fishing Inflatable Boats: These specialized boats are designed with fishing in mind. They typically feature spacious decks, built-in storage for fishing gear, and a stable platform for standing and casting.

Key Advantages of Using a Gommone

  1. Portability: One of the primary benefits of a gommone is its portability. Inflatable boats can be deflated and packed into a compact bag, making them easy to store and transport. This is a significant advantage for those who don’t have the space for a large, rigid boat or for travelers who need to take their vessel on vacation.

  2. Affordability: Compared to traditional boats, gommone are relatively inexpensive. The cost of construction and materials is lower, and maintenance is typically easier and less costly. For those on a budget, a gommone offers an excellent alternative to more expensive boating options.

  3. Versatility: Gommone come in various shapes, sizes, and designs, making them suitable for a wide range of activities, from leisurely outings to intense water sports. Some models are even designed for specific purposes, such as rescue operations, military applications, or professional fishing.

  4. Ease of Use: Operating a gommone is relatively simple, even for beginners. Many models come with easy-to-understand controls, and the inflatable tubes offer excellent stability, making them a safe and reliable choice for newcomers to boating.

  5. Durability: Despite being inflatable, gommone are often made from tough materials that resist punctures and abrasions. Hypalon, one of the most common materials used, is known for its resistance to UV rays, ozone, and extreme temperatures, making it incredibly durable for long-term use.

How to Choose the Right Gommone

When selecting a gommone, there are several factors to consider:

  1. Size and Capacity: Depending on the number of people who will use the boat, you’ll need to choose an appropriate size. Gommone come in various lengths, from small two-person models to larger boats that can accommodate several passengers.

  2. Material: As mentioned earlier, gommone are typically made from PVC or Hypalon. While both materials are durable, Hypalon tends to have better resistance to UV rays and is more suitable for long-term use in harsher conditions.

  3. Engine Power: If you plan to use your gommone for fast-paced activities, you’ll need to consider the engine power. High-speed models require more powerful engines, while smaller, leisure-oriented boats can be paired with modest engines.

  4. Intended Use: Choose a gommone that suits your specific needs. For example, if you plan to use the boat for fishing, look for models with spacious decks and ample storage. If you want a boat for emergency or military purposes, durability and ruggedness will be your priority.
